| Contents: | Inherited genetic disorders and inherited social orders -- The prism of heritability and the sociology of knowledge: what questions? Whose questions? -- The genetic screening of "target" populations -- Dilemmas of a "general" genetic disorder control policy -- Neutrality and ideology in genetic disorder control -- The increasing appropriation of genetic explanations -- Eugenics by the back door -- Human genetics, evolutionary theory, and social stratification -- Afterword: The new and emerging relationship between behavioral and molecular genetics. |
